2. Obstacles Of Reusing Solar Panels



It is extensively approved that reusing solar panels has lots of environmental benefits, however, it is also real that the procedure isn't without its difficulties. However what exactly are these obstacles? Allow's check out additionally.



One of the most significant problems with reusing solar panels is the complexity of the job itself. It can be challenging to break down the different parts, such as glass and steel, to be reused individually. Additionally, solar panel suppliers often have a mix of products utilized in their items that makes sorting them a lot more complicated. Furthermore, there are security and health and wellness threats included with dealing with broken glass or inhaling fumes from melting parts.

One more crucial difficulty related to reusing solar panels is price. Many nations do not have enough infrastructure or sources to adequately reuse these products which causes greater costs for companies trying to do so. In addition, due to the specific nature of recycling photovoltaic panels, this can produce a financial concern on firms trying to remain certified with guidelines. Inevitably, these prices could be passed down to consumers making it difficult for them to pay for renewable resource resources.
